WebApr 20, 2024 · Here are the top 10 facts about Mount Fuji. 1. It is a composite volcano. Mount Fuji is made up of three volcanoes. There are three separate volcanoes on top of one another. The bottom layer of the volcano is Komitake, followed by Kofuji and finally Fuji at the top and is the youngest. Geographically, Mt. Fuji is the tallest mountain in Japan ... After the last eruption ( Hōei eruption ), lava and volcanic ash destroyed many farms near Mt. … Mount Fuji is located at a triple junction trench where the Amurian Plate, Okhotsk Plate, and Philippine Sea Plate meet. These three plates form the western part of Japan, the eastern part of Japan, and the Izu Peninsula respectively. The Pacific Plate is being subducted beneath these plates, resulting in volcanic activity.
